 As part of my 2 month physically active researching period on a project Embodied flow in motion I am interested in exploring embodied flow in motion in 7 phases (slow flow, free flow, bound flow, open-spiral fluidity, fluid touch, floating sound, imagery flow, flow re-patterning) through embodied movement practices. In the context of this research, for me embodiment through fluidity has many stages and possibility to achieve fluid movement requires knowledge and experience of moving the body according to feelings, present state of mind, consciousness, breath support, good body coordination, spine mobility and stability, connection with the ground, sound, how to listen and act. I am interested in how to achieve stillness in movement, and also what is happening when we break the flow and start with another element, or just turn it to another direction. How this movement can become holistic and organic and still fluid and integrated? Can we transcend our ordinary consciousness and become so completely involved that we lose our senses of time and self?
I will develop practices that will base on elements of fluid movement, touch, voice, sensing, participative observing, reflecting and bring to mind a sense of connection to the embodied flow in motion.

about my methodology...

 My methodology is constant research. I will take into account connection from pragmatism (Dewey, James, Piaget), phenomenology (Husserl, Kant, Hegel, Merleau-Ponty) and existential philosophy (Kierkegaard, Pascal) combined with other valuable somatic approaches and vivid thoughts of contemporary somatic movement researcher and thinker (Laban, Fraleigh, Eddy, Csikszentmihalyi, Olsen, Cottrell, Cooper Albright, Pallaro, Maoilearca,..)
My idea is to apply embodied, phenomenological and pragmatic approach and skills of reflection and try to explore this creativity, reflectivity, transformation and according to Husserl “flowing change’ of conscious perception in movement with an amount of physically and mentally abled practitioners within the limits of their skills who are willing to express and expand their awareness in the movement, according to the state of presentness, emotions and breath, including dynamic interplay of experience and outer expression of space harmony and body limitation. Phenomenological aspect leads us from conscious experience into conditions that help to give experience its intentionality. Conscious is important in somatic work and unique for disembodied participation. We experience. This experiential or first person feature is an essential part of the nature structure of conscious experience. When I say, I move, I act, I think, I breathe, I desire, I live, … this is phenomenological an ontological feature of my experience to be experienced and meta cognition of what it is for the experience to be. 

I will use quantitative and qualitative research method, but I will certainly put an accent on the qualitative aspect of the research. This will allows me to reflect on my own experience as a researcher as part of the process and could provide datas about emotions, sensing, state of presentness. During the research I will combine action research and grounded theory so participants could continue to review, evaluate, request and improve practice either just keep questioning and examine the findings of participant observation and then proceeds to the analysis of those findings before any other data are collected. I will also involve reflective autobiography and interpretation of personal experience with the help of research diary to illustrate embodiment through fluidity more truthfully. During the research project I will use desk-based research of existing/available information, systematic literature reviews, policy analysis and case study (in-depth investigations of a single person, group may require observations and interviews). gathering data...

 Participants will not be excluded according to any criteria. Will be approached and contacted via email and social media sites. Participation will be voluntary and participants will always have a right to withdraw from the research. Participants will be treated confidentially and anonymity will be made clear about the sessions and participants role in the research study.
